Homeowners typically see a range in tune-up costs for an oil furnace, driven by service scope, part needs, and local market rates. The price is influenced by system age, nozzle types, and safety checks. This guide shows cost ranges in USD and practical breakdowns for budgeting.
| Item | Low | Average | High | Notes |
|---|---|---|---|---|
| Diagnostic & Safety Inspection | $60 | $120 | $180 | Includes burner check, flame inspection, and vent safety |
| Oil System Tune-Up | $120 | $210 | $350 | Burner adjustment, nozzle replacement, nozzle filter, fuel line check |
| Parts & Materials | $20 | $90 | $300 | New nozzle, filter, gaskets, and seals as needed |
| Labor & Service Call | $60 | $150 | $250 | Typical regional shop rates plus travel |
| Totals (Typical) | $260 | $570 | $1,080 | Assumes standard tune-up without major repairs |
Overview Of Costs
Oil furnace tune-ups have predictable components yet vary by system complexity and local labor markets. Typical projects show a total range from about $260 to $1,080 for a standard service, with most homeowners in the $500–$700 band. The per-unit ranges below help set expectations for budgeting.
Assumptions: region, basic maintenance, no major repairs, single unit, standard efficiency oil furnace

What Drives Price
Key price drivers include burner type, nozzle rating, and annual fuel use. Oil furnace efficiency measured as AFUE influences parts and tuning steps; units with AFUE under 80 percent may warrant more inspection. Another driver is equipment age; older nozzles and fuel lines may require replacement to maintain safe, efficient operation.
Labor, Hours & Rates
Typical tune-ups take 1.0–2.0 hours for a straightforward service. data-formula=’labor_hours × hourly_rate’>Labor cost hinges on local rates, with urban areas often at the high end. A basic tune-up may clock in around 1 hour, while a furnace with access issues or additional safety checks can exceed 2 hours.
Regional Price Differences
Prices vary by region and urban density. In the Northeast, higher labor costs can shift averages upward, while rural areas may price closer to the low end. Midwest markets often fall near the national average. The following illustrates typical deltas: Urban +15–25% vs Rural, Coastal markets +10–20%, and Midwest markets around baseline.
Labor & Installation Time
Install time and crew costs impact total pricing. A two-person crew with an apprentice may complete a standard tune-up faster than a single licensed technician in a tight space. Expect added time if access is restricted or the system uses older components.
Extras & Hidden Costs
Possible additions include nozzle upgrades for efficiency, filter replacements, or safety-device checks beyond the standard scope. Hidden costs can appear if follow-up adjustments are needed after initial testing or if fuel lines require cleaning due to contamination.
Real-World Pricing Examples
Three scenario cards show how input variations affect final pricing. Assumptions: standard installation in single-family home
Basic
Spec: standard nozzle, basic burner check, standard filter. Labor 1.0 hour. Total: $260–$320. Per-unit: $120–$180 for the tune-up components.
Mid-Range
Spec: nozzle upgrade, full safety checks, fuel line inspection. Labor 1.5 hours. Total: $420–$570. Per-unit: $210–$270.
Premium
Spec: advanced combustion adjustment, extra filter set, possible minor parts replacement. Labor 2.0 hours. Total: $680–$1,080. Per-unit: $320–$520.
Assumptions: region, unit age, and labor hours vary; ongoing maintenance may reduce long-term fuel use
Seasonality & Price Trends
Prices may shift with demand cycles, especially before winter peaks. Scheduling in the shoulder seasons can help avoid surge pricing and reduce wait times. A routine tune-up during off-peak months often comes with promotional pricing, yielding noticeable savings on total project cost.
Maintenance & Ownership Costs
Routine tune-ups can lower long-term maintenance bills by preventing dirty burners and inefficient combustion. Over a 5-year span, consistent maintenance can improve reliability and reduce annual energy waste, though part wear like gaskets and filters remains a recurring expense.
